Conditional Fields..
I have 2 Regions called Region 1 and Region 2. Reg 1 has 4 divisions; Div 1,
div 2 etc. Reg 2 has only 2 divisions. Can I create a mergeed document that creates the line "Your region 1 has the following divisions: ........(it would then say 1 2 3 & 4)". For the reg ion 2 document it would only have division 1 & 2. I know this is confusing but the data I am trying to merge has many more regions and divisions. Thanks. |

Sounds like you are probably trying to perform a "multiple items per
condition (=key field)" mailmerge which Word does not really have the ability to do: See the "Group Multiple items for a single condition" item on fellow MVP Cindy Meister's website at http://homepage.swissonline.ch/cindy...faq1.htm#DBPic Or take a look at the following Knowledge Base Article http://support.microsoft.com/default...b;en-us;211303 http://www.knowhow.com/Guides/Compou...poundMerge.htm -- Hope this helps.
